Should I buy the 3 Series Gran Limousine?
BMW 3 SERIES GRAN LIMOUSINE is a perfect choice for the driving enthusiast who wants sheer driving pleasure from behind the wheel. The Gran Limousine is the EWB version which has enhanced the rear seat leg space by elongating the wheelbase. This has resulted in a better and richer experience in the rear seats. Experience luxury and power with the 320 Ld. Its strong and elegant design ensures safety and premium quality, making it worth the investment. If you seek a top-tier driving experience with a diesel engine and impressive road presence, the 320 Ld is the perfect choice for you.
- The 2023 BMW 3 SERIES GRAN LIMOUSINE showcases an updated design, presenting a futuristic and premium look. The redesign includes a more sleek kidney front grille, and a new headlamp design, incorporating new dual LED DRLs as eyebrows.
- The side profile features 18” M sport-specific alloy wheels. The design of the alloy wheels is appealing across both variants.
- The rear of the 3 series has also been modernized, featuring L-shaped new LED taillamps and redesigned rear bumpers.
- The biggest update inside is the new 14.9” infotainment touchscreen and 12.3” instrument clusters. They are a single-piece curved display. They take the cabin experience a step further. The 14.9” touchscreen easily connects to your smartphone wirelessly. The digital instrument cluster impresses with its versatility.
- The parking and the reversing assistant features can handle the most difficult parking spot with ease.
- The 16-speaker Harmon Kardon surround sound speaker system enhances the cabin experience by providing a sophisticated sound experience that fits perfectly with the interior space.
- The rear seats now offer a much premium experience and all thanks to the EWB version. The presence of the head cushions for the rear seat passengers helps in providing extra luxurious comfort.
- The front seats are damn comfortable. The bolstering and the extendable under-support for the thighs help to enhance the cabin experience.
- The 330 Li comes equipped with a 2 L inline 4-cylinder petrol engine that produces approximately 260 BHP of power with 400 Nm torque. It comes equipped with an 8-speed Steptronic gearbox which is blistering quick in shifts.
- The 320 Ld has a 2 L inline 4-cylinder diesel engine. It makes 190 BHP and 400 Nm torque. It uses the same 8-speed Steptronic gearbox.
- Since it is an RWD vehicle, you can have some fun with the rear wheels and both the vehicles come with launch control as well.
- The 3 series Gran Limousine comes with an M Leather steering wheel. It provides brilliant handling and makes driving a sheer fun experience. That's what BMWs are famous for. The steering is light and adjusts its weight based on the selected drive modes. Speaking of drive modes, it offers three options: Eco, Normal, and Sport. Engaging Sport mode unleashes the full power of the diesel/petrol motor.
- At lower speeds, it offers a great feel, but as the speed increases, it becomes more stable and enjoyable to drive. Handling triple-digit speeds is effortless, and it adeptly absorbs bumps and breakers on the road.

Latest Updates on 3 Series Gran Limousine
To celebrate 50 years of the BMW 3 Series, BMW introduced the ‘Jahre’ limited edition for the 330Li Long Wheelbase and M340i, with production limited to just 50 units each, making them highly exclusive collector models.
The BMW 3 Series Long Wheelbase 330Li (M Sport) has reportedly been delisted from BMW India’s online configurator, and as of now, the company has not issued any official explanation. The variant was launched only recently, which makes its sudden disappearance from online listings quite unusual.
The next-generation BMW 3 Series has been spotted testing ahead of its global debut, which is expected around 2026, marking the model’s eighth generation. It is set to adopt BMW’s new Neue Klasse design language, featuring a redesigned kidney grille, slimmer lighting elements, and a more futuristic styling approach.
The 2025 BMW 3 Series Long Wheelbase (LWB) has been launched with a new diesel engine option, priced at Rs 62 lakh (ex-showroom), expanding the sedan’s powertrain lineup in India.
